Campaign design

The calculator follows booked meetings through show rate, opportunity acceptance, close rate, contract value, and gross margin. Results compare campaign cost with expected pipeline, customers, revenue, and gross profit. The approach uses the smallest workable scope, tests the assumptions, records outcomes, and expands after the evidence supports more investment. That sequence protects budget while the company pursues a realistic view of outbound appointment economics.

Measure appointment setting ROI calculator with the same definitions across each reporting period. Record scope changes, pauses, staffing limits, and sales outcomes on the date they occur. Stable definitions help management separate market conditions from changes in delivery or internal execution.
